public async Task <Hero3Camera> BurstRateAsync(BurstRate burstRate) { return(await base.PrepareCommand <CommandCameraBurstRate>().Select(burstRate).ExecuteAsync() as Hero3Camera); }
public Hero3Camera BurstRate(out BurstRate burstRate) { burstRate = base.ExtendedSettings().BurstRate; return(this); }
public Hero3Camera BurstRate(BurstRate burstRate, bool nonBlocking = false) { return(ExecuteMultiChoiceCommand <CommandCameraBurstRate, BurstRate>(burstRate, nonBlocking)); }